Tierbefreiung und soziale Revolution

Vom Veganarchismus oder Anarchaveganismus

Pamphlet

German language

Published May 15, 2005 by Autonome Tierbefreiungsaktion Hannover.

View on OpenLibrary

View on Inventaire

No rating (0 reviews)

1 edition